Webb27 okt. 2024 · This effect, known as the Pygmalion Effect, is an example of a self-fulfilling prophecy involving interpersonal processes. As Rosenthal put it: “When we expect certain behaviors of others, we are likely to act in ways that make the expected behavior more likely to occur.”. Rosenthal & Babad, 1985. Video. Webbför 2 dagar sedan · In Volume 1, Hartley utilises Newtonian science in his observations, presenting his theory of 'vibrations'. Volume 2 is particularly concerned with human morality and the duty and expectations of mankind.
